The Dansko Wide Pro Black Cabrio Clog is a supportive, all-day clog featuring a roomy reinforced toe box, a padded instep collar, and a protective heel counter for lateral stability. Underfoot it uses a single-density open-cell PU foam footbed and a PU rocker-bottom outsole designed to promote forward motion and shock absorption. The wide fit is intended to accommodate wide feet comfortably. ★ Ideal forIt's specifically a Wide Pro clog with a roomy reinforced toe box plus a protective heel counter and stable inner frame, which helps wide-foot wearers get both space and stability for cross-training.

The RAD ONE V2 is an all-around training shoe with springy EVA cushioning, a stable platform for lifting, and a grippy herringbone rubber outsole. Its flexible mesh upper and rope-climb-ready sidewall design suit CrossFit, strength training, plyometrics, gymnastics, and everyday gym use. ★ Ideal forIt suits wide-footed cross trainers because its medium-to-wide toe box and wider fit provide more room, while the flexible mesh upper, stable platform, and grippy herringbone outsole support dynamic training.

The TYR CXT-2 is a cushioned cross-training shoe with a responsive SURGENRG foam midsole, stable heel, TPU Stability Strap, and grippy TYRTAC outsole. Its 4mm-wider frame and broad size range suit athletes who want comfort and stability for lifting, CrossFit, and varied gym workouts. ★ Ideal forThe CXT-2 suits wide-footed cross-training because its frame is 4mm wider than the CXT-1, offers an extra-wide option, and provides a roomy anatomical fit with a 13.1 oz cushioned platform.

The Savage 1 is a lightweight cross-training shoe with a dual-density EVA midsole, wide toe box, TPU stabilizers, and durable rubber traction. It suits athletes who combine lifting, HIIT, short runs, jumping, and lateral movements in one workout. ★ Ideal forIt suits wide feet specifically because it has a wide toe box measuring 95mm in men's size 9, while the dual-density EVA midsole and stable TPU heel support provide comfort and control during cross training.
